Definitions for "RPD"
Chinese-made light machine gun
The Ruchnoi Pulemet Degtyarev, was a light machine gun used by the VC / NVA and was normally of Soviet manufacture
a 7.62 mm Communist machine gun with a 100-round, belt operated drum that fires the same round as the AK-47

Relative Percent Deviation
Relative percent difference. A measure of precision, calculated by: Rd% = [X1 - X2}/Xave x 100 where: X1 = concentration observed with the first detector or equipment; X2 = concentration observed with the second detector, equipment, or absolute value; and Xave = average concentration = ((X1 + X2) / 2) The relative percent difference (RPD) and coefficient of variation (COV) provide a measure of precision, but they are not equal. REMOTE PRIMARY DIAGNOSIS. An emerging application of teleradiology in which x-ray, CT, ultrasound, and MRI images are scanned into computer systems and transmitted to alternate locations, allowing primary diagnosis to be made from the scanned image, rather than the film itself. RPD allows radiologists to more quickly review and evaluate images and provide more timely diagnosis without the added delay and expense of traveling to a hospital or clinic or waiting for films to be mailed or shipped to their offices. Also known as central read.
JUNOS software routing protocol process (daemon). A user-level background process responsible for starting, managing, and stopping the routing protocols on a Juniper Networks router.
